Murata 1400 Series High Current Radial Inductors


Designed for use in power line applications such as switching regulators, filters and suppression circuits

Constructed from high saturation flux density material enabling use in high current applications

Suitable for PCB or chassis mounting using a non-magnetic fastener via the central fixing hole

Terminated with easy-strip pre-tinned enamelled copper leads

Lead length 10mm

Operating temperature: -40 → +85°C

Inductance Tolerance: ±10%
